Great stuff, my son and friends use it. Personally I don't get PI, though am very careful since the immunity fades the more you touch it. My son is highly allergic and uses it. They also make wipes which may be easier on the trail.
The best advice is to be aware of where you're walking, know where it tends to grow and what it looks like. When you make camp, go around and ID all the PI and remember where it is, so you don't go stumbling into it at night.
Here's a pretty good quiz that will help you ID PI... though if you're not sure just try to stay away from it all.

You can also use products made for removing poison ivy to get pepper oil off your hands. My go to after dealing with peppers is technu. It works like a charm and is safer for kitchen and food related uses.
